GRI Hosts Annual Employee Appreciation Lunch at the Modesto Carseum

Updated: Nov 25, 2024



George Reed Inc. marked a milestone this year—celebrating 80 years of exceptional service, community impact, and dedication to the construction industry. To express gratitude for the hard work and commitment of its employees, the company hosted its much-anticipated Annual Employee Appreciation Lunch at the Modesto Carseum.


The event brought together employees from all departments for a day of camaraderie, celebration, and fun. With a warm and festive atmosphere, employees were treated to a delicious BBQ.


In addition to the tasty feast, the event featured a thrilling raffle which added an extra layer of excitement to the afternoon, with winners walking away with fantastic rewards.


This year’s luncheon was even more special as it doubled as a celebration of George Reed Inc.'s 80 years in business. Since its founding, George Reed Inc. has been a cornerstone in the industry, consistently delivering quality service and fostering a culture of excellence. The company’s longevity is a testament to the dedication and hard work of all its employees, and this event was a way to thank them for their ongoing contributions.


The Annual Employee Appreciation Lunch at the Modesto Carseum was a resounding success, leaving everyone with full hearts, full bellies, and a renewed sense of pride in being part of the George Reed family. Here’s to another 80 years of success, growth, and teamwork!
